- http://82.156.39.91:8418/window-installation-companies9028
-
Looking for expert window installers? Our team of professionals guarantees top-notch service to enhance your home's appeal and energy efficiency. Schedule your consultation today!
- Joined on
Loading Heatmap…
best-aluminium-wi... created repository best-aluminium-wi.../5850aluminum-window-companies
1 week ago